Activity data rates
| Activity | MB/hour |
|---|---|
| Streaming SD video | 700 |
| Video calls (Zoom, FaceTime) | 450 |
| Social media (Instagram, TikTok) | 200 |
| Navigation (Google Maps, Waze) | 150 |
| Messaging (WhatsApp, iMessage) | 50 |
| Email and web browsing | 60 |
| Music streaming | 100 |

Device setup
Before departure
Purchase the plan 1 to 3 days before your flight. Install the QR code on WiFi. Name the eSIM "Slovenia Data" to keep it separate from your home line. Do not enable data roaming on your home SIM.
iPhone setup
- Settings > Cellular > Add eSIM
- Scan the QR code from Airalo
- Label the line "Travel Data"
- Set as default data line
Samsung setup
- Settings > Connections > SIM Manager
- Add eSIM > Scan QR code
- Rename the line "Travel Data"
- Set as mobile data SIM
Google Pixel setup
- Settings > Network > SIMs
- Add SIM > Scan QR code
- Rename the line "Travel Data"
- Set as data SIM
After landing in Slovenia
Turn off airplane mode after landing. Telekom Slovenije's 5G network picks up your eSIM automatically. Test the connection by loading a web page. Make sure your home SIM has data roaming disabled.

Can I switch plans mid-trip in Slovenia?
Yes. Buy a second eSIM through the provider app while in Slovenia. Most phones support 8+ eSIM profiles. Delete the expired plan to free a slot. You do not lose your home number.

How far in advance should I buy my Slovenia eSIM?
Buy 1 to 3 days before departure. Install the QR code over WiFi at home. The validity timer starts at first network connection in Slovenia, not at purchase. This gives you time to troubleshoot any installation issues before your flight.
